The Isa Uranium Joint Venture, located 40 kilometres north of Mt Isa, in northern Queensland, consists of three major uranium deposits, namely; Skal, Odin and Valhalla. These uranium deposits are considered to be important to the future of the Queensland economy and to the general Australian economy, if world demand for uranium increases, as it is forecast to occur, in the latter half of the 2000's.

Isa Uranium Joint Venture Owned by Paladin Energy Limited

The Isa Uranium Joint Venture partners include; Summit Resources (Aust.) Pty Ltd (50 percent) and Mount Isa Uranium Pty Ltd (50 percent). Mount Isa Uranium Pty Ltd is a subsidiary company belonging to Valhalla Uranium Pty Ltd. Valhalla Uranium was formerly a public company but it is now fully owned by Paladin Energy Limited. Paladin Energy Limited therefore holds over 91 percent interest in the Isa Uranium Joint Venture because of its over 82 percent interest in Summit Resources.

Paladin Energy is a Global Uranium Resource Company

Paladin Energy Limited is listed on the Nambian Stock Exchange, the Toronto Stock Exchange and the Australian Securities Exchange. It also trades on the Frankfurt, Stuttgart, Berlin and Munich Exchanges. Paladin is an uranium producing resource company operating two mines in Africa and the Isa Uranium Joint Venture in Australia. It is aiming to become a major world uranium producer.

The Skal Deposit is Part of the Isa Uranium Project

The Skal uranium deposit was discovered 30 kilometres north of the regional centre of Mt Isa. The drilling of 57 holes totalling 9,592 metres of the deposit was completed in 2011. The drilling completed resource drill outs of 40 metres by 40 metres. The Skal uranium deposit consists of a number of ore lenses that are concentrated in four main zones within an area of two square kilometres.

Odin Uranium Deposit is Included in the Isa Uranium Project

The Odin uranium deposit is located 41 kilometres north of Mt Isa and just one kilometre north of the Valhalla uranium deposit. In 2010 a 99 hole totalling 16,044 metres resource definition drilling program was completed on the Odin deposit. The Odin deposit contains two mineral lenses and a strike length of 600 metres.

The Isa Uranium Project Includes the Valhalla Deposit

The Valhalla uranium deposit that is located 40 kilometres north of Mt Isa was discovered in 1954.

The first work on the deposit was carried out by MIM when it sunk an exploration shaft into the mineralised ore body. Queensland Mines Limited took over the project in the 1960's and carried out extensive drilling programs until 1992 when Summit Resources Limited acquired it. The Mt Isa Joint Venture with Valhalla Uranium Limited identified the Valhalla uranium deposit as being significant remaining open along strike to the south and north and at length.

The Isa Uranium Joint Venture program's further development will depend on political decisions on whether mining of uranium should be allowed to occur in Queensland as much as that of world demand for the product.
